Job Description
- Job Description:
- Design, develop, and maintain backend services and APIs for our IAM platform
- Collaborate with product managers, other software engineers, and security experts to build product features
- Develop and maintain Access Intelligence features
- Develop and maintain identity lifecycle management features
- Implement logging, monitoring, and auditing capabilities
- Continuously optimize and improve the performance, security, and scalability of the IAM platform
- Stay current with industry trends and emerging technologies in identity and access management
- Requirements:
- Proven 4+ years in backend software development
- Bachelor's or Master's degree in Computer Science, Engineering, or a related field
- Strong proficiency in one or more programming languages, such as Golang, Java
- Experience designing and implementing RESTful APIs and microservices architectures
- Solid understanding of authentication and authorization protocols, standards, and best practices
- Experience with cloud platforms, such as AWS, Azure, or Google Cloud Platform
- Experience with containerization and orchestration technologies, such as Docker and Kubernetes is a plus
- Knowledge of database technologies (SQL and NoSQL), caching mechanisms, and distributed systems
- Excellent problem-solving skills, attention to detail, and ability to work independently and collaboratively in a fast-paced environment
- Strong communication and interpersonal skills.
- Benefits:
- Competitive benefits package
- Equity opportunities
Apply tot his job
Apply To this Job